Output 63b7cb88c40aa5bd53328ef6641ed10bb206a955772de586473fc689617d604f:17

value
1861857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ef1375e0a69ed8ea3410407990e6b3fe5bb7ee9 OP_EQUALVERIFY OP_CHECKSIG
address
15HD3prXDs4Eg5i5VA5TqYS7DmDpeLjN15
transaction
63b7cb88c40aa5bd53328ef6641ed10bb206a955772de586473fc689617d604f
spent
true